💡 What is Flare (FLR)?
Flare (FLR) is an EVM-compatible Layer-1 blockchain designed to enhance interoperability between blockchains lacking native smart contract functionality (like XRP Ledger) and external data sources. Its core mission is to bridge decentralized applications (dApps) with secure, decentralized data feeds through innovative protocols such as the State Connector and Flare Time Series Oracle (FTSO).
Key Features of Flare:
- Interoperability: Connects disparate blockchains for seamless asset/data transfers.
- EVM Compatibility: Supports existing Ethereum smart contracts without modifications.
- Decentralized Oracles: FTSO provides reliable price/network data for DeFi applications.

How Flare Works: Core Mechanisms
1. State Connector
- Function: Securely retrieves and verifies off-chain data (e.g., from other blockchains) without centralized intermediaries.
- Use Case: Enables cross-chain smart contracts and trustless integration with external networks.
2. Flare Time Series Oracle (FTSO)
- Decentralized Data Feed: Aggregates price/network data from independent providers.
- Rewards System: Incentivizes accurate data submission through weighted averages.
3. EVM Compatibility
- Developers can port Ethereum dApps to Flare effortlessly using familiar tools (e.g., MetaMask, Hardhat).
4. Native Interoperability
- Facilitates communication between blockchains (e.g., Bitcoin, XRP) via the State Connector, eliminating reliance on centralized bridges.
Use Cases and Applications
Flare’s architecture supports diverse Web3 applications:
- DeFi: Expands decentralized finance to non-smart-contract chains (e.g., XRP, Bitcoin) via FAssets.
- Gaming: Integrates verifiable randomness and cross-chain assets.
- Data Monetization: Rewards users for contributing accurate oracle data.

FAQ Section
1. What makes Flare unique?
Flare’s State Connector and FTSO enable secure cross-chain data sharing without centralized bridges, setting it apart from traditional oracles.
2. How does Flare ensure data accuracy?
FTSO uses a decentralized network of providers incentivized to submit precise data, with rewards tied to performance.
3. Can I stake FLR on exchanges?
Yes, but delegating via the Flare Portal offers higher transparency and control.
4. Is Flare suitable for DeFi projects?
Absolutely—its EVM compatibility and oracle system make it ideal for interoperable DeFi apps.
5. What’s FLR’s max supply?
102 billion tokens, with 58.3% allocated to community growth.
